阅读量:0
Ruby代码优化是一个相对主观的话题,因为优化的难易程度取决于多个因素,如代码的复杂性、质量、可维护性以及开发者的经验和技能。
对于简单的Ruby代码,优化可能相对容易,因为代码量较少,问题可能更容易被发现和解决。然而,对于复杂的Ruby代码,优化可能需要更多的时间和精力,因为需要深入理解代码的逻辑和结构,找出性能瓶颈并进行相应的改进。
此外,Ruby语言本身提供了一些优化技巧和工具,如使用更高效的算法和数据结构、避免不必要的全局变量和重复计算、使用缓存来减少计算量等。这些技巧和工具可以帮助开发者更容易地进行代码优化。
总的来说,Ruby代码优化是一个需要一定经验和技能的过程,但是通过学习和实践,开发者可以逐渐掌握这些技巧和方法,并优化他们的Ruby代码。因此,可以说Ruby代码优化是可能的,但需要付出一定的努力和时间。